The latest, Chinese-language issue of the Financial and Economic Review, containing a selection of papers, was published by the Magyar Nemzeti Bank, the central bank of Hungary on
1 February 2022, on the first day of the Chinese Lunar New Year. This issue contains some of the most read papers published in last year. 

The Editorial Board of the Financial and Economic Review decided to continue also in 2022 the initiative started in 2018 and publish another issue of selected papers in Chinese language. Our goal is to make available the prominent analyses of our journal to one of the fastest growing scientific workshops with the largest number of members in the world, i.e., to a much wider readership. The honourable interest in the Chinese-language publications also proves that this Chinese-language scientific educational journal is a gap-filling initiative.

As the publisher, the Magyar Nemzeti Bank primarily seeks to support scientific education and the further deepening of Chinese-Hungarian economic-diplomatic relations by putting out an issue in Chinese.

The selected articles in this issue examine the dilemmas of introducing the euro, digital financial innovation, decentralized finance, the treatment of foreign exchange liquidity shocks in the euro area banking system, the effects of leverage and the role of gold, and the Eurasia Forum 2021.
